This I Believe: I Believe In Connection

I cry every day. My tears are tears of anguish but also tears of the most intense joy. I don’t think I am depressed. I think I am responding appropriately to our contradictory and often terrifying world of conflict and violence. I think I am also in a constant state of amazement and wonder at the many quotidian miracles I witness…and how astonishing is Mother Nature’s delicate balance. Recently my husband and I saw a tiny baby black bear chasing a newborn spotted fawn dashing precariously across South Atherton Street, just before the town of Boalsburg. We still cannot believe it happened. I have discovered that some of us have been nourished by a profound sense of beauty and empathy at life on Planet Earth. This doesn’t mean I don’t also feel repelled by institutional racism, rampant cruelty, indifference, and denial. Take Note: Cariol Horne And Damon Jones On The Need To Reform Against Police Brutality

Veteran law enforcement officers Damon K. Jones and Cariol Horne are speaking out against police brutality and calling for reform. They talked with WPSU about the challenges they have faced as minorities in the police force, their thoughts about the Black Lives Matter movement and why change is necessary. Transcript: Cheraine Stanford: Welcome to take note on WPSU. I'm Cheraine Stanford. We're joined today by two activists advocating for law enforcement reform. Cariol Horne was a police officer in Buffalo, New York, for nearly two decades. When she was fired after she says she was assaulted by a fellow officer while attempting to stop him from choking a handcuffed man. Damon K. Jones has worked in the West Chester Department of Corrections for 28 years. He represents the state of New York in the organization, Blacks in Law Enforcement of America. Take Note: Founder Of Human Rights Organization On Community Work To End Female Genital Cutting

Molly Melching first went to Senegal in 1974 as an exchange student from the University of Illinois. But, instead of returning to the United States, she stayed on, eventually creating a nonprofit organization to educate and empower women and communities. That organization Tostan created and implemented educational programs focused on human rights, health, literacy, financial management and childhood development. It may be best known for leading thousands of communities in Africa to end female genital cutting and forced childhood marriage. WPSU's Anne Danahy talked with Melching about her work.
